California Exotic Novelties Addresses Phthalates Use

CHINO, Calif. — Sex toy manufacturer California Exotic Novelties in a press release has ensured retailers and consumers of product safety relative to its use of phthalates, a chemical used to soften plastics and often found in flexible adult toys.

The company said the minimal amount of phthalates that some of its products contain has no correlation with human health issues. CalExotics relied on results of several international studies to determine its products are harmless to users.

In a 1982 study, high doses of phthalates were found to cause various health problems in lab rodents, including cancer. Whether those results can be attributed to humans, however, has been debated.

CalExotics also offers a line of phthalate-free products. A list of these items is available via email.

The company plans to clearly mark its product packaging with ingredients labels to inform consumers of what they are purchasing.
